Bomb threats ahead of Sri Lanka Independence parade

COLOMBO, Feb 4 (Reuters) - A caller claiming to be from a rebel group Sri Lanka's military says is a wing of the Tamil Tigers on Monday warned of bomb attacks on Independence Day celebrations due to take place in the capital Colombo within hours.

"Please, be careful. There are going to be bombs in Colombo in some places," the caller told Reuters, saying he represented 'Ellalan Forces' -- a name the military identified as Tiger fighters operating in the capital.

The caller was unknown to Reuters, and hung up when asked if he was linked to the Liberation Tigers of Tamil Eelam. The Tigers were not immediately reachable for comment.

"Ellalan forces ... are those operating in Colombo," said military spokesman Brigadier Udaya Nanayakkara. "It's the Tigers." (Reporting by Simon Gardner; Editing by Sanjeev Miglani)
